Regulator

A state-appointed individual or body with oversight powers in industries such as gas, water and electricity generation / distribution – where the services are provided by one supplier (e.g. a power grid operator) or a very limited number of suppliers. Project Documents

The commercial contracts and other agreements relating to a project to which the lenders are NOT party and which have been identified as “Project Documents” in the loan and security agreements. Power Purchase Agreement (PPA)

A structured – typically long-term – offtake arrangement between a power-generator SPV and a power Offtaker. The offtaker may be a public or private sector entity.
